Output 65c568d00609ae3176780ce39d76c7c52705453cbe503323861aefe90e3b32fd:20

value
64563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0193e5024db634de35d2ef61798ad2a13396d052 OP_EQUAL
address
31qMmdWGT5sxnJTPU6kSfQD3i25Fkw2YgV
transaction
65c568d00609ae3176780ce39d76c7c52705453cbe503323861aefe90e3b32fd